为您找到"

main(){int i,n=0 for{(i=2:i<5;i++){do{if(i%3) continue;n++;}whi...

"相关结果约100,000,000个

main() {int a=0,i; for(i=1;i<5;i++) { switch(i) { case0: case3:a...

楼主你贴的代码有问题,我估计是这样的,这样算的就是31 include <stdio.h> main(){ int a=0,i;for(i=1;i<5;i++){ switch(i){ case 0:case 3:a+=2;case 1:case 2:a+=3;default:a+=5;} } printf("a=%d\n",a);} 计算步骤:i=1,走case 1:没break,下面都会执行,a+=...

#include <stdio.h> main() { int k=4, n=0;

main(){ int k=4, n=0, i =1;for (;n<k;i++){ printf("\n\n\n第%d次进入for循环时n=%d\n执行n++:\n", i, n);n++;printf("n=%d\n",n);if (n%2 == 0){ printf("因为n模2等于0, 所以结束本次for循环\t");printf("k还=%d, n=%d\n",k,n);continue;}else...

c语言数组题,求解

for(i=0;i<n;i++){ if(a[i]%2==1 && a[i]>max){ max = a[i];} } return max;} int main(){ int num[10];int i;int max;srand((unsigned int)time(NULL));for(i=0;i<10;i++){ num[i] = rand()%90 + 10;printf("%d\t",num[i]);} printf("\n");max =...

请大神解析下c语言程序 main() { int i,j,k; for(i=0;i<=3

printf("*"); printf("\n"); //打完星是不能忘空格的 } for(i=0;i<=2;i++) //这里是打下半部分的星星。可以与上同样理解。。。 { for(j=0;j<=i;j++) printf(" "); for(

C语言编程 求1 -3 5 -7 9 ...前20项和

include <iostream> using namespace std;int _tmain(int argc, _TCHAR* argv[]){ int da[20];int sum=0;for( int i=0; i<20; ++i ){ if(0==i%2)//如果i是偶数,也就是第0、2、4……位数 { da[i]=2*i+1; //为1、5、9等正数 } else da[i]=-(2*i+1); //...

main() { int i,n=0,s=0; for(i=1;i<=10;i++) { n=2*i-1; s=s+n...

这样,for语句就可以理解为 for(循环变量赋初值;循环条件;循环变量增值)语句 以上,表达式1,表达 式2 ,表达 3 都可以省略;但是(分号;)是不能省略;所以应该改为:main(){ int i=1,s=0;for(; i<=10;i++) //在i<=10的前面少了一个(分号;)s=s+i;printf("%d\n",s);...

谁能帮我看看为什么n的输出值是3???灰常感谢!!

只有012 n++了当然是3;读到\0字符 for 就循环结束了

...main( ) { int x=10,y=10,i; for(i=0;x > 8;y=++i) printf("%d,%d...

D、10 10 9 1 第一次执行 for(i=0;x > 8;y=++i) // 此时x = 10, 这句y=++i要循环体执行完后执行,即执行完printf后,在执行到for时。printf("%d,%d ",x--,y); // 先输出后计算,所以输出10,10,之后x执行减一,x=9.第二次执行 for(i=0;x > 8;y=++i)...

写一个函数int prime(int x),判断数值x是否素数,如果是返回1,否则返回0...

源代码如下:include <stdio.h> include <math.h> int prime(int x){ int i;for(i=2;i<x;i++)if(x%i==0)return 0;else return 1; } main(){ int x,m;printf("请输入需要判断的数字:\n");scanf("%d",&x);m=prime(x);if(m==1){ printf("%d是素数\n",x); } else...

for ( int i=1 ; i<1000;i++){ int p=0; for(int j=1; j<=i/2;j++...

这是一个循环嵌套语句。for就是循环的意思,i = 0:表示i是从0开始循环。i< 1000:表判断,看是否在此范围内,若在,则执行下列语句,否则跳出。i ++ :表示 i 从 0 一直递增。第二个也是一样的意思。这整个要求的其实是求1000以内每一个数的因数之和 ...
1 2 3 4 5 6 7 8 9

相关搜索